小编wnd*_*ndg的帖子

configure:error:找不到boost.filesystem库

所以我试图通过这个github安装ncmpcpp ,第一步是运行sh autogen.sh脚本.我遇到了一些丢失的库等等,但我已经能够安装它们并继续进行到现在为止.我已经做了一些搜索并安装了一些我认为有助于修复它的东西,但无济于事.

sudo apt-get install libboost1.55-all-dev

sudo apt-get install libboost-system-dev

sudo apt-get install libboost-system1.54-dev

sudo apt-get install libboost1.54-dev

sudo apt-get install libboost-filesystem-dev

sudo apt-get install libboost-filesystem-dev libboost-thread-dev

真相是我对Boost不了解或者我缺少自己解决的问题.

这是问题的开始:

检查boost/filesystem.hpp ...是的

在-lboost_filesystem-mt中检查main ...没有

configure:error:找不到boost.filesystem库

编辑:以下是config.log文件中'-lboost_filesystem-mt'的周围行.

configure:15510:在-lboost_filesystem-mt中检查main

configure:15529:g ++ -o conftest -g -O2 -std = c ++ 0x conftest.cpp -lboost_filesystem-mt>&5

/ usr/bin/ld:找不到-lboost_filesystem-mt

collect2:错误:ld返回1退出状态

配置:15529:$?= 1

configure:失败的程序是:

|/*confdefs.h*/

...然后继续描述confdefs.h文件.

c++ linux ubuntu boost

3
推荐指数
1
解决办法
3897
查看次数

标签 统计

boost ×1

c++ ×1

linux ×1

ubuntu ×1